Output 26bf429b21545c21c305cdac84d0bdb3c6768b4cf8cfe5f2b01cbbf0a2d87b70:5

value
312358757
script pubkey
OP_HASH160 OP_PUSHBYTES_20 41047eb3d88b5bce5787e681e4bd6fd61d641630 OP_EQUAL
address
MDpwYDH6Q28iagQ6YqNtedy26Yg8uJeTMY
transaction
26bf429b21545c21c305cdac84d0bdb3c6768b4cf8cfe5f2b01cbbf0a2d87b70
spent
true